How Bus Accidents Can Differ from Other Collisions
Getting into any accident is frightening, but when a bus is involved, the aftermath can be even more overwhelming. These crashes often lead to serious injuries, complicated legal questions, and a long road to recovery. Here’s why bus accident cases can be especially challenging:
- Buses are large and heavy, so when they collide with smaller vehicles or objects, the impact is often devastating.
- More people tend to be involved, which means multiple injuries and more complex investigations.
- Responsibility isn’t always clear. The driver, the bus company, a government agency, another motorist, or even the bus.
- Legal protections for public transit systems can make filing a claim more difficult and time-sensitive.
- Multiple insurance companies may be involved, making it harder to know who to talk to or who’s really on your side.
- The injuries are often severe, sometimes requiring months or even years of care, rehab, or assistive devices.

Factors Contributing to Bus Accidents in Scottsdale
To pursue a successful personal injury claim, we must identify the root cause of the crash and prove another party was negligent. Common causes of bus wrecks in Arizona include:
- Distracted driving
- Fatigue
- Speeding
- Driving under the influence
- Improper or infrequent vehicle maintenance
- Mechanical failures or defective parts
- Inadequate driver training or licensing
- Hazardous road or weather conditions
- Reckless driving
- Collisions with pedestrians or other vehicles
- Missing or faulty emergency tools (lights, signage, or exits)
- Unfamiliarity with bus routes or terrain
- Violating traffic laws

Act fast if you’ve been hurt in a bus accident. Arizona’s statute of limitations for personal injury claims typically allows two years from the accident date to file a personal injury claim. Missing the deadline means you can’t claim any compensation.
